GOLD COAST

Usually we share light-hearted information that the majority of our readership wants to read.  Though this is more of a commercial project, it's indicative of the signs of the Chicago market showing better signs of life than other areas.

Cityfront Place was placed on the market yesterday by Northwestern Mutual Life Insurance Co.  This move could awaken the downtown multi-family (i.e. apartment) investment market from a two-year slumber.

EVANSTON

In a move to keep local residents more informed and aware of what's happening in the city council meetings, Evanston officials agreed to move their meetings and replays to live streaming over the Internet.

This would allow residents to not only watch over Web but also make comments.  It also gives non-residents the opportunity to learn more before joining the community as well as provide access for those who are not able.
